Hallo liebe Community,
ich war früher schon mal in der Community aktiv, kann aber leider meinen Benutzernamen nicht wiederfinden, und die damals verwendete Emailaddy ist nicht mehr vorhanden, somit musste ich mich neu registrieren.
Ich habe folgendes Problem.
Ich hab 3 Tabelle:
1 Tabelle Projekte in der Datenbank X
2 Tabelle Details, Mitarbeiter in der Datenbank Y
Die Tabelle sind folgender Maßen aufgebaut:
Tabelle Projekte: Felder ProjektID, sonstige Felder(nicht relevant)
Tabelle Details: Felder ProjektID, Mitarbeiter ID, Zeit, Datum
Tabelle Mitarbeiter: Felder MitarbeiterID, Name
Ich benutze dass Jquery Plugin Datatables und will in dieser Tabelle Daten ausgeben, was auch grundsätzlich funktioniert. Grundsätzlich is nicht zu jedem Datensatz aus Projkete ein Daten Satz
Mein Problem: Ich will zu jedem Projekt, den Mitarbeiter ausgeben, der zuletzt an dem Projekt gearbeitet hat, also geordnet nach der Zeit:
Ich habe den Query vereinfacht dargestellt und den Rest weggelassen. Einen einfachen Join zu machen ist ja nicht das Problem, aber irgendwie hab ich gerade keinen Ansatz, wie ich nun aus der Ausgabe, die mir mit diesem Query alle Detaildatensätze zu dieser ProjektID ausgibt, meine Wunschausgabe bekomme.
Wie mache ich daraus einen Query, der mir nur den neuesten Datensatz aus Details gibt, und diesen dann auch noch mit der Mitarbeiter Tabelle verknüpft, sodass ich den richtigen Namen bekomme?
Hoffe ihr könnt mir helfen..stehe echt aufm Schlauch
Grüße
Paul
ich war früher schon mal in der Community aktiv, kann aber leider meinen Benutzernamen nicht wiederfinden, und die damals verwendete Emailaddy ist nicht mehr vorhanden, somit musste ich mich neu registrieren.
Ich habe folgendes Problem.
Ich hab 3 Tabelle:
1 Tabelle Projekte in der Datenbank X
2 Tabelle Details, Mitarbeiter in der Datenbank Y
Die Tabelle sind folgender Maßen aufgebaut:
Tabelle Projekte: Felder ProjektID, sonstige Felder(nicht relevant)
Tabelle Details: Felder ProjektID, Mitarbeiter ID, Zeit, Datum
Tabelle Mitarbeiter: Felder MitarbeiterID, Name
Ich benutze dass Jquery Plugin Datatables und will in dieser Tabelle Daten ausgeben, was auch grundsätzlich funktioniert. Grundsätzlich is nicht zu jedem Datensatz aus Projkete ein Daten Satz
Mein Problem: Ich will zu jedem Projekt, den Mitarbeiter ausgeben, der zuletzt an dem Projekt gearbeitet hat, also geordnet nach der Zeit:
Code:
SELECT Projekte.ProjektID, Details.MitarbeiterID
FROM Projekte
INNER JOIN
Details
ON
Projekte.ProjektID = Details.ProjektID
Ich habe den Query vereinfacht dargestellt und den Rest weggelassen. Einen einfachen Join zu machen ist ja nicht das Problem, aber irgendwie hab ich gerade keinen Ansatz, wie ich nun aus der Ausgabe, die mir mit diesem Query alle Detaildatensätze zu dieser ProjektID ausgibt, meine Wunschausgabe bekomme.
Wie mache ich daraus einen Query, der mir nur den neuesten Datensatz aus Details gibt, und diesen dann auch noch mit der Mitarbeiter Tabelle verknüpft, sodass ich den richtigen Namen bekomme?
Hoffe ihr könnt mir helfen..stehe echt aufm Schlauch
Grüße
Paul
Zuletzt bearbeitet: